*ISLAMABAD – Pakistan Tehreek-e-Insaf (PTI) Chief and Primeminister-in-waiting Imran Khan has left a special message for the people ofPakistan on the occasion of Independence day.*
*He has stressed the need for unity to confront challenges faced by thecountry. *
In his message on the occasion of the 71st anniversary of Independence fromBritish rule, Khan said: “14 Aug 2018: On this Independence Day I am filledwith the greatest optimism.
Despite our grave economic crises, due to corruption & cronyism, I know ifwe are united in our resolve, we will rise to the challenge & Pak willbecome the great nation envisaged by our Quaid & Iqbal.”
Sharing a picture from Round Table Conferences held between 1930-32 inLondon, he siad: “In this historic picture of Quaid-i-Azam & Iqbal, at theRound Table Conference in London 1932, my khalu Dr Jehangir Khan and mymother’s chacha Zaman Khan ( Zaman Park named after him ) were also present.
